US scientists improve photoresponsivity in solar perovskite by 250%

Researchers led by the University of Rochester claim to have increased the photoresponsivity of a lead-halide perovskite for solar cell applications by 250%. They created a perovskite film with a plasmonic substrate made of hyperbolic metamaterial and characterized it with transition dipole orientation.

China produced 288.7 GW of modules, 827,000 MT of polysilicon in 2022

China’s Ministry of Industry and Information Technology (MIIT) says Chinese manufacturers produced 357 GW of wafers and 318 GW of solar cells in 2022.

Replacing MPPT with direct PV-battery coupling

Researchers in Germany have assessed direct coupling and integration between PV and batteries at the scale of a single PV module. They say their solution could be cheaper and provide superior performance than maximum power point tracking (MPPT) in optimizing PV system performance.
